Choreographer Paul Gazzola offered a reprise off his duet having Aimee Smith and you will Jessyka Watson-Galbraith that have Yep. This new bit worked quite ideal with its earlier gallery expression in the Artrage inside March, this new theatrical restaging right here with one thing from a uniformity out of rhythm. On Artrage the task ended up being characterised of the quiet rests irregularly moving on ranging from a lot of time, pregnant holes and you can less of them, hence alternated with moments regarding quick gesticulatory craft. Hand saluted otherwise slice the air till the trunk, detailing the bedroom quickly in the body, while the including suggesting a great florid, opaque vocabulary. Voice developer Dave Miller http://www.datingranking.net/nl/instanthookups-overzicht fired off selection off their Computer game collection since musicians and artists launched with the movement, out of a standing condition, so you can whines away from “Yep!” Unison try broadly managed, prior to anything ran faulty (“Exactly what?” spectators wondered) and something performer established “Nup!” This may be all of the came to a halt because for each performer burdened in order to understand the newest objectives of most other. The room is actually reconfigured in general performer strode to another position-typically having one incapable of personally see the most other-and you may instantly they began again. During the that distinguished time at Artrage, both Smith and you will Watson-Galbraith tramped additional and you can along the path, faraway echoes out-of “Yep! ... Nup!” getting together with bemused onlookers from the gallery.
Which piece turned into a great speculating online game towards the musicians in public demonstrating and you will vocalising the principles-mainly based construction of one's partial-improvised works, even though the along with withholding all the details to allow you to definitely fully decode their procedures. Inquiries regarding as to why, exactly what assuming danced about any of it organised screen out-of abstraction.
Inside the Falling To the, dance-inventor Olivia Millard seemed on her behalf very own, demonstrating a strong feeling of directional path and you can moving inertia. She violently put this lady foot out from her sides, resulting in this lady physical stature so you're able to pivot up until now and dramatically move away trailing it within the a counter-controlling step. Immediately following a beneficial whirlwind away from severe dynamism, traversing one another walls and you can floors, Millard paid towards the a reduced, meditative phase, almost intimate, created from new inward contemplation off her own embodiment and asleep inside just one pool from white. So it first point-the strongest inside the portion-try followed closely by equally lyrical material in which dancer Paea Leach joined Millard to do some sluggish, gymnastic weight-exchanges and you will poses. The result right here as well is actually increased by the performers' amount, but really worried about its productive rental of each and every other's regulators. New duo produced a stimulating compare, Millard with a superb, elongated setting where in fact the limbs extended the fresh new type of the upper body, if you're Leach's wider shoulders recommended a very weighty, muscular exposure.
